Understanding the Complexity of Truck Accident Cases

Texas truck accident cases involve intricate legal and technical elements that require specialized knowledge. Unlike standard vehicle accidents, truck crashes often involve multiple potentially liable parties, including the truck driver, trucking company, cargo loaders, maintenance companies, and even truck manufacturers. Under Texas law, commercial trucking companies must carry substantially higher insurance coverage than regular drivers, often ranging from $750,000 to $5 million or more, depending on the type of cargo being transported.

The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) regulations add another layer of complexity to these cases. A qualified truck accident attorney must understand hours-of-service regulations, mandatory rest periods, vehicle inspection requirements, and proper cargo loading procedures. These federal regulations work in conjunction with Texas state laws to create a comprehensive legal framework that requires extensive experience to navigate effectively.

Investigating Resources and Case Preparation

Truck accident cases require immediate and thorough investigation. The right attorney will have established procedures for preserving crucial evidence, including the truck’s electronic control module (ECM) data, driver logbooks, maintenance records, and cargo documentation. In Texas, trucking companies are required to maintain specific records for designated time periods, but this evidence can be lost or destroyed if not preserved quickly.

A qualified semi-truck accident lawyer will also understand the importance of investigating the trucking company’s safety record, the driver’s history, and any potential violations of federal or state regulations. This investigation often reveals patterns of negligence that can significantly strengthen your case.

Understanding Fee Structures and Costs

Most reputable truck accident l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ning you don’t pay attorney fees unless they secure a settlement or verdict in your favor. However, it’s important to understand what percentage the attorney will take and how case expenses will be handled. Some firms advance all case costs, while others may require clients to pay certain expenses upfront.

Be wary of attorneys who quote unusually low contingency fees, as this may indicate they plan to settle quickly rather than fighting for maximum compensation. The most experienced Texas truck accident lawyers understand that thorough case preparation often leads to substantially higher settlements that more than justify their fees.

Texas follows modified comparative negligence rules, meaning your compensation may be reduced if you’re found partially at fault for the accident. However, as long as you’re less than 51% responsible, you can still recover damages. An experienced Texas 18-wheeler accident attorney will know how to minimize any comparative fault allegations and maximize your recovery.
